Abstract

Various kinds of orientalist studies on Islam began in the early 19th century, such as studies of the al-Qur`an, hadith, fiqh, and others. One of the orientalist who study Islam from the aspect of the Qur'an is Abraham Geiger. Geiger said, that there are several aspects of the Qur'an that adopted by Jewish traditions. Based on these reasons, the resecher are interested in studying this theme further. This study is a study of library research, with descriptive-analysis method. The conclusion of this study is that some Muslim scholars acknowledge the influence of Islam from other religions, not only from the linguistic aspect of the Qur'an, but also from the empirical-practical, and Islam comes to renew and modify the traditions of previous religions that are not in accordance with values of Islam.
